I have a problem with embeded fonts in FP8 (only in FP8!);
Maybe you
would agree to have
a look at this problem, it is very simple and rapid to
understand (but
maybe not to solve?)
I create the file "font.swf" with the
following xml:
<?xml version="1.0"
encoding="iso-8859-1" ?>
<movie width="320" height="240"
framerate="12">
<background color="#ffffff"/>
<frame>
<font id="papyrus"
import="library/PAPYRUS.TTF"
<glyphs="0123456789"/>
</frame>
</movie>
and I create another swf file "gal.swf" where
I want to use the font
in "font.swf", whit the xml:
<?xml version="1.0"
encoding="iso-8859-1" ?>
<movie width="2800"
height="2000" framerate="60">
<background color="#ffffff"/>
<frame>
<import file="font.swf"
url="font.swf"/>
</frame>
</movie>
Then I re-compile the file "gal.swf" with
mtasc (without ant "header"
parameter, for sure) and the following actionscript code:
_level0.createTextField("essai",0,0,0,100,20)
_level0.essai.text="blablabla"
_level0.essai.embedFonts=true
var my_fmt:TextFormat = new TextFormat();
my_fmt.font = "papyrus";
my_fmt.size=20;
_level0.essai.setTextFormat(my_fmt);
This works when I compile for FP 6 or 7 (mtasc parameter
-version) but
not for FP8...
However, compiling the last actionscript code directly in
the file
"font.swf" works even with FP8. But I don't
want to include the font in
every swf file I use...I could load the file
"font.swf" with actionscript
in "gal.swf" without embeding to font but doing
this I can't use the
"advanced"
anti-aliasing mode for the text.. Have you a solution to
this problem??
